| Feature | Description | Seasonal Highlights | Visitor Benefits |
|---|---|---|---|
| Native Tree Canopy | Oak, hickory, and maple species establish long-term shade and structure | Leaf-out in spring, color in fall | Cooler microclimate, wildlife nesting sites |
| Understory Plantings | Serviceberry, dogwood, and native shrubs fill mid-layer | Spring blooms, summer berries | Screening, seasonal interest, pollinator forage |
| Trail Network | Loop paths and connectors for walking, jogging, and exploration | Accessible in most conditions | Low-impact exercise, family-friendly outings |
| Habitat Features | Log piles, rock outcrops, and pond edges increase biodiversity | Active year-round | Wildlife observation, photography opportunities |
Native Plant Diversity in Honey Creek Woodlands
The plant palette in Honey Creek Woodlands is selected to mimic local prairie-woodland edges, giving year-round structure and resources. Layering trees, shrubs, and groundcovers supports a wider range of insects, birds, and small mammals than simplified landscapes.
Key Species by Canopy Layer
Overstory trees are tough natives adapted to local soils and moisture, while mid-story species add seasonal color and fruit. Groundcover choices reduce erosion, suppress weeds, and bloom in succession from early spring through late summer.
Wildlife Habitat and Pollinator Support
Dense shrub layers, seed heads, and decaying wood provide food and shelter for pollinators, songbirds, and beneficial insects. Seasonal blooms ensure nectar and pollen availability, while diverse structure offers nesting sites and shelter from predators and weather.
Ecological Management and Restoration Practices
Active stewardship using prescribed fire, selective thinning, and native seedings maintains the intended open canopy and understory diversity. Removing invasive shrubs and prioritizing local genotypes helps the woodlands adapt to shifting conditions over time.

How does the site contribute to local climate resilience and stormwater management?
The preserved soils, deep roots, and layered vegetation slow runoff, increase infiltration, and store carbon, helping buffer adjacent neighborhoods from heat and heavy rain events.
